GETR graphite irradiation capsules: H-4, 5, 6 equivalent N Reactor exposure (open access)

GETR graphite irradiation capsules: H-4, 5, 6 equivalent N Reactor exposure

A program for the irradiation of samples-of N-Reactor graphite has been in progress since November 30 1961, in the General Electric Test Reactor (GETR). The basic purpose of the program is to achieve an exposure to the samples equivalent to 20 years of operation of N-Reactor and to relate the physical distortion of the samples to the expected behavior of the N-Reactor moderator stack. Theoretical studies to relate sample exposure in the GETR to exposure in N-Reactor have been underway since the program began. The conversion of exposure depends on three main items: the flux and exposure in the GETR test position; the flux and exposure in the N-Reactor stack; and the relationship of the amount of carbon damage per unit flux in N-Reactor to that in the GETR. To date all three items of the conversion have been based strictly on computer calculations. The first item (the GETR flux) has been calculated as group one, E > 0.18 MeV, of the three-group computation made every reactor cycle by the GETR physics group, This computation is normalized to reactor conditions by comparison of group three, E < 0.17 ev, with measured cobalt-alloy monitors.
